@charset "utf-8";
/* CSS Document */

body { 	margin:0px;
		padding:0px;
		background-image:url(../images/background.jpg);
		background-repeat:no-repeat;
		background-position:top center;
		background-color: #092F5E;
		padding-top:0px;
		padding-bottom:0px;
		}
p { margin:0px; }

img.op{ filter:alpha(opacity=65); -moz-opacity:0.65; opacity:0.65 }
.c { text-align:center; }
.u { text-decoration:underline; }
.b{ font-weight:bold; }
.i{ font-style:italic; }
.s10{ font-size:10px; }
.s11{ font-size:11px; }
.s12{ font-size:12px; }
.s13{ font-size:13px; }
.s14{ font-size:14px; }
.s16{ font-size:16px; }
.s17{ font-size:17px; }
.s18{ font-size:18px; }
.s24{ font-size:24px; }

form, ol { padding-top:0px; padding-bottom:0px; margin-top:0px; margin-bottom:0px; }
.mainpadding { padding:6px 20px 6px 20px; }
.mainpadding1 { padding:9px 0px 0px 0px; }
.arial{ font-family:Arial, Helvetica, sans-serif; }
.verdana{ font-family:Verdana, Arial, Helvetica, sans-serif; }
.arialnarrow { font-family:Arial Narrow; }
.color1{ color:#10016A; }
.color2{ color:#FFFFFF; }
.color3{ color:#22A4E8; }
.color4{ color:#0B6A90; }
.color5{ color:#376388; }

.alignleft {
float: left;
padding-left:12px;
padding-bottom:4px;
}
.alignright {
float: right;
padding-right:0px;
padding-bottom:4px;
 }

/*padding areas*/
.padding1 { padding:0px 20px 12px 20px; }
.padding2 { padding:0px 25px 0px 0px; }
.padding3 { padding:0px 0px 0px 0px; }
.padding4 { padding:0px 0px 0px 0px; }

.repeat { background-repeat:no-repeat; background-position:top center; }

/*default color on text-links and text-decoration*/
a.white:link, a.white:visited { color:#FFFFFF; text-decoration:none; }
a.white:hover { color:#FFFFFF; text-decoration:underline; }

a.orange:link, a.orange:visited { color:#741D00; text-decoration:underline; }
a.orange:hover { color:#741D00; text-decoration:none; }

a.black:link, a.black:visited { color:#221E1F; text-decoration:underline; }
a.black:hover { color:#221E1F; text-decoration:none; }

a.blue:link, a.blue:visited { color:#646363; text-decoration:none; }
a.blue:hover { color:#376388; text-decoration:none; }

a.green:link, a.green:visited { color:#0B6A90; text-decoration:none; }
a.green:hover { color:#0B6A90; text-decoration:underline; }

#textbox { font-family:century gothic; 
		font-size:9px;}
/*main_nav_top*/ 
.horizontal { 
		text-align:center; 
		font-family:Arial; 
		font-size:12px; 
		text-decoration:none; 
		color:#ffffff;
		outline:none;
		}
.hnav { font-family:Arial, Helvetica, sans-serif; 
		font-size:12px;
		text-decoration:none; 
		outline:none;
		}
.hnav a{ font-family:Arial, Helvetica, sans-serif; 
		font-size:12px; 
		text-decoration:none; 
		padding:4px;
		outline:none;
		color:#ffffff;
		font-weight:bold;
		}	
.hnav a.current { color:#ffffff; }
.hnav a:hover { color:#ffffff; }

.terminal { text-align:center;
			padding-top:40px;
		}
.tnav {	
		text-decoration:none;
		text-transform:uppercase;
		font-family:Arial; 
		font-weight:bold; 
		font-size:10px; 
		color:#FFFFFF;
		padding:0px 7px 0px 7px;
		}
.tnav a{ 
		text-decoration:none;
		text-transform:uppercase;
		font-family:Arial; 
		font-weight:bold; 
		font-size:10px; 
		color:#FFFFFF;
		padding:0px 7px 0px 7px;
		}
.tnav a:link { 
		text-decoration:none;
		text-transform:uppercase;
		font-family:Arial; 
		font-weight:bold; 
		font-size:10px; 
		color:#FFFFFF;
		padding:0px 7px 0px 7px;
		}
.tnav a:visited { 
		text-decoration:none;
		text-transform:uppercase;
		font-family:Arial; 
		font-weight:bold; 
		font-size:10px; 
		color:#FFFFFF;
		padding:0px 7px 0px 7px;
		}

/*css navigation*/		
.hnav { text-align:center; margin:0px; padding-top:85px; }	 
.horizontal div a:link { text-decoration:none;
						 text-transform:uppercase; 
                         font-family:Arial; 
						 font-size:12px;
						 font-weight:lighter;
						 color:#FFFFFF;
						 padding:4px 5px 4px 5px; 
						 margin-right:12px;
						 margin-left:12px;
						 }
.horizontal div a:visited { text-decoration:none;
						 text-transform:uppercase; 
                         font-family:Arial; 
						 font-size:12px;
						 font-weight:lighter;
						 color:#FFFFFF;
						 padding:4px 5px 4px 5px; 
						 margin-right:12px;
						 margin-left:12px;
							}
.horizontal div a:hover { text-decoration:none;
						 text-transform:uppercase; 
                         font-family:Arial; 
						 font-size:12px;
						 font-weight:lighter;
						 color:#FFFFFF;
						 background-color:#7A1E00;
		   				 border:1px solid #FFFFFF;
						 padding:4px 5px 4px 5px; 
						 margin-right:12px;
						 margin-left:12px;
						 }
#current { background-color:#7A1E00;
		   border:1px solid #FFFFFF;
		   padding:4px 5px 4px 5px; 
		   margin-right:12px;
		   margin-left:12px;
		    }